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. (AMD) produces semiconductor products and devices. The Company offers products such as microprocessors, embedded microprocessors, chipsets, graphics, video and multimedia products and supplies it to third-party foundries, as well as provides assembling, testing, and packaging services. AMD serves customers worldwide.

The product portfolio of the company includes Chromium Controller, Reagent Kits, 10x Compatible Products, and Informatics Software among others. The majority of its revenue is generated from consumables.
